Output 188689aca506246c3c48d9a06200bf40969320dd563e36aae6bd4e0e51f3eb6c:25

value
95944106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cbd354c247ae21367c8100c2ee911bc909b0969 OP_EQUAL
address
MAX7pDYojYEGCkFdU85vWtWbFYtBAycqL6
transaction
188689aca506246c3c48d9a06200bf40969320dd563e36aae6bd4e0e51f3eb6c
spent
true